Conditions

None

Interventions

Table Tennis Group:12 weeks of table tennis training, 3 times a week, 120 minutes each time, with progressive training guided by professional coaches (grip, footwork, forehand and backhand shots, spin
Intensity: Heart rate maintained at (220-age) ×60-70%
Control Group:Maintain habitual lifestyle
No structured exercise programs allowed

Eligibility

Sex/Gender
All
Age
55 Years to 65 Years

Inclusion criteria

Inclusion criteria: 1. Age 55-65 years old; 2. Be in good health (no history of cardiovascular disease, nervous system disease, bone and joint disease); 3. Irregular exercise habits in the past 2 years (exercise <=1 time per week); 4. No experience in table tennis; 5. Voluntarily participate and sign the informed consent form.

Exclusion criteria

Exclusion criteria: 1. Combined with serious medical diseases (hypertension, diabetes, abnormal liver and kidney function); 2. Orthopedic/joint surgery within 3 months; 3. Presence of balance dysfunction (such as Meniere's disease, vestibular neuritis); 4. Planned long-term absences (>=2 weeks) during the study period.

Design outcomes

Primary

MeasureTime frame
Single-leg stance;Reaction time;Hand-grip strength;Body composition;Serum MDA content;Serum T-AOC level;Serum CAT activity;Serum SOD activity;
